Endocrine Surgery

Content

As board-certified, fellowship-trained endocrine surgeons, Baylor Medicine physicians offer specialized care to patients in Houston and the surrounding area, with thyroid nodules, goiter, Graves’ disease, thyroid cancer, hyperparathyroidism, adrenal masses, pheochromocytoma, Cushing’s syndrome and Conn’s syndrome.

Thoracic Surgery

Content

Thoracic Surgery specializes in the care and treatment of patients with benign and malignant disorders of the chest cavity (thorax). This includes lung cancer, esophageal cancer, thymoma, mesothelioma and all other malignancies involving the thorax.

Vascular Surgery

Content

Physicians at Baylor Medicine Vascular provide a full spectrum of diagnostic evaluation and interventional treatment of problems with arterial and venous blood flow in the lower extremities, and problems with walking or wound healing related to reduced blood flow (claudication or limb salvage).
